How to build it? > My tries with aclocal/autoconf/automake shows missing elements. It doesn't build yet.. what was submitted is stripped down from the full original. Soon I will work on reconstituting it so it actually builds and works (waiting on commit access). This will be as an interpreter only, which will result in discarding a bunch of unrelated stuff like the Java-to-C code generator (I'm planning on keeping the ELF loader for now, as it could conceivably someday be used as a way of loading disk-cached JIT output). Of course anything that's discarded will really still be there in SVN. -Archie __________________________________________________________________________ Archie Cobbs * CTO, Awarix * http://www.awarix.com
